std::atomic_ref<T>::fetch_xor – std::atomic_ref<T>::fetch_xor
Synopsis
T fetch_xor(T arg, (since C++ 20)
std::memory_order order = std::memory_order_seq_cst) const noexcept;
(member only of atomic_ref<Integral> template specialization)
Atomically replaces the current value of the referenced object with the result of bitwise XOR of the value and arg. This operation is a read-modify-write operation. Memory is affected according to the value of order.
Parameters
arg – the other argument of bitwise XOR
order – memory order constraints to enforce
Return value
The value of the referenced object, immediately preceding the effects of this function.
